我们提供融合门户系统招投标所需全套资料,包括融合系统介绍PPT、融合门户系统产品解决方案、
融合门户系统产品技术参数,以及对应的标书参考文件,详请联系客服。
在信息化建设日益成熟的背景下,“融合门户”作为一种整合多系统资源、提供统一访问入口的技术方案,逐渐成为企业及组织的核心需求。融合门户旨在打破信息孤岛,实现跨平台、跨系统的数据互通和服务共享。本文将围绕“介绍”这一基础功能模块,从需求分析到技术实现进行全面阐述。
### 需求背景
某大型企业集团计划构建一个融合门户平台,用于集中展示内部各业务系统的概况。该平台需具备以下核心功能:
1. **用户友好性**:提供直观、简洁的操作界面。
2. **模块化设计**:支持灵活扩展不同业务模块。
3. **权限管理**:依据用户角色分配访问权限。
4. **动态更新**:能够实时同步各子系统的最新状态。
针对上述需求,“介绍”功能作为门户首页的重要组成部分,需要清晰呈现企业概况、系统导航以及重要公告等内容。
### 技术架构与实现
本项目采用Java语言结合Spring Boot框架进行开发,前端使用Vue.js构建响应式页面,后端通过RESTful API提供服务。数据库选用MySQL存储静态文本数据,同时集成Redis缓存机制以提升读取效率。
#### 数据库设计
创建`introduction`表,定义字段如下:
CREATE TABLE introduction (
id INT AUTO_INCREMENT PRIMARY KEY,
title VARCHAR(255) NOT NULL COMMENT '标题',
content TEXT COMMENT '内容',
status ENUM('active', 'inactive') DEFAULT 'active' COMMENT '状态'
);
#### 后端接口实现
后端通过Spring Boot Controller暴露`/api/introduction`接口,用于获取介绍信息:
@RestController
@RequestMapping("/api")
public class IntroductionController {
@Autowired
private IntroductionService introductionService;
@GetMapping("/introduction")
public ResponseEntity getIntroduction() {
IntroductionDTO dto = introductionService.getIntroduction();
return ResponseEntity.ok(dto);
}
}

#### 前端展示逻辑
前端利用Axios调用后端接口,并将数据渲染至页面:
mounted() {
axios.get('/api/introduction')
.then(response => {
const { title, content } = response.data;
this.title = title;
this.content = marked(content); // 使用marked库解析Markdown格式内容
})
.catch(error => console.error(error));
}

### 结论
本文通过详细描述融合门户中“介绍”功能的设计与实现过程,展示了如何满足实际业务场景下的技术需求。未来,可进一步优化性能监控与日志记录功能,确保系统的稳定运行。
综上所述,融合门户不仅提升了用户体验,还为企业数字化转型提供了坚实的技术支撑。
]]>